Output ebc84b405362b1ded7b51cb48437fe3f43b94e8e55dbe12e905a82860e50a6c8:10

value
27906111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b4d6fa19e59af3cb2f4cd1e5428a2da1b04ffa OP_EQUAL
address
MN6Tc8WVDSkryLm8p1YCzdGuz1NDmGgdeG
transaction
ebc84b405362b1ded7b51cb48437fe3f43b94e8e55dbe12e905a82860e50a6c8
spent
true